“…The K b is 5.00–5.96 × 10 5 M −1 , and the average binding-site number is about 1.2. The positive value of ∆S (and ∆H near to 0) suggested that electrostatic interactions exist between the complex and CT-DNA ( Yang et al, 2011 ; Heydari and Mansouri-Torshizi, 2016 ; Seyedi et al, 2020 ; Shao et al, 2021 ). The negative value of ∆G shows the spontaneity of the reaction, and the negative value of ∆H reveals that the interaction of the Fe complex with DNA is exothermic.…”
